Chance Miller / 9to5Mac:
Kuo: an iPhone SE with 5G is coming in H1 2022; a cheaper 6.7" iPhone and two high-end models with a punch-hole display and 48MP wide camera are due in H2 2022  —  Following last week's release of the iPhone 13 lineup, reliable Apple analyst Ming-Chi Kuo is out with new expectations for what to expect from the iPhone 14.

Wall Street Journal:
Sources: the SEC has launched an investigation into Activision Blizzard, including how it handled employees' allegations of sexual misconduct and discrimination  —  Agency has issued subpoena to videogame company and several executives including CEO Bobby Kotick
Benjamin Bain / Bloomberg:
Coinbase quietly updates its blog to say it is tabling the launch of Lend, a product intended to pay users interest for lending out tokens, after SEC pressure  —  - Company faced threat by agency to sue if it pursued plan  — SEC has taken a tougher line on crypto under Gary Gensler

Lorenzo Franceschi-Bicchierai / VICE:
Europol, alongside Italian and Spanish police, arrest 106 people accused of working for the Italian Mafia and laundering over €10M made through cybercrimes  —  European police accused several people of SIM swapping, phishing, and hacking in support of Italian organized crime.
Todd Spangler / Variety:
Filing: Twitter agrees to pay $809.5M to resolve claims from 2016 that it provided misleading engagement information to investors  —  Twitter disclosed a binding agreement to settle a class-action lawsuit, under which the social network will pay $809.5 million to resolve claims it provided misleading engagement info to investors.
